- The_Automatic_Box abstract "The Automatic Box is a four-disc box set by R.E.M., released in Germany in December 1993. It was primarily a collection of B-sides from Automatic for the People, though disc four contains B-sides from Green-era singles (then collected on the 7" vinyl box set Singleactiongreen). "It's a Free World Baby," "Fretless," "Mandolin Strum," and "Organ Song" were outtakes recorded during Out of Time recording sessions. This is part of a Warner Bros. Records series, also with the Red Hot Chili Peppers Live Rare Remix Box.".
